10th grade Trignometry homework help please?

Lighthouses
t2wksfrm20 asked:


Ok so i'm having a lot of trouble with this problem. Please help or give hints if you can.

A boat is sailing due east parallel to the shoreline at a speed of 10 mph. At a given time, the bearing to the lighthouse is S70 degrees E, and 15 minutes later the bearing is S 63 degrees E. The lighthouse is located at the shoreline. What is the distance from the boat to the shoreline?
